.: about the training
Traditional Shotokan is a
safe and non-contact form of Japanese karate where the training strives to
improve muscle tone, flexibility, physical endurance, knowledge of self-defense,
and more. Beginning classes are slow-paced and introduce a thorough overview
of the basic techniques and traditional concepts. Advanced training
consists of expanding on those concepts, and classes are more physically
challenging. The class environment is informal, yet focuses on the
exercise value and a expansion of traditional karate concepts.
The instructor, Jeffrey Everett,
has been studying and training karate since 1983, and has been teaching for
nearly 25 years at dojos in North Dakota, Minnesota, Oklahoma, and currently in
Florida at Sports and Field.
